Executive Order 82 - Accelerating Socio-Economic Dev in Regions,-Strengthening RDCs.

Executive Order 82  was issued by Philippine on President Ferdinand R. Marcos Jr. on 28 January 2025  reconstituting the regional development councils (RDCs) to accelerate socio-economic development in all regions.

Under EO 82,  Marcos designated at least 12 government agencies and offices as additional members of RDCs in an effort to speed up the economic and social growth and development of the units.

New RDC members are the regional heads of the Commission on Higher Education, Department of Education, Department of Energy, Bureau of Local Government Finance, Department of Human Settlements and Urban Development, Department of Information and Communications Technology, Department of Migrant Workers, Department of Transportation, Cooperative Development Authority, Office of Civil Defense, Technical Education and Skills Development Authority, and Philippine Information Agency.

“The Philippine Development Plan 2023-2028 highlights the importance of supporting the thrust towards regional development and rationalizing government functions, systems and mechanisms in achieving deep social and economic transformation in the country,” EO 82 read.

“It is imperative to further reorganize the RDCs to strengthen their role in the pursuit of regional socio-economic development,” it added.

EO 82 directs the National Economic and Development Authority (NEDA) and the Department of Budget and Management (DBM), both members of the RDCs, to jointly issue guidelines for the strengthening of regional investment programming and budgeting.

The NEDA and the DBM are instructed to coordinate with relevant government agencies as they issue guidelines for the prioritization of key programs, projects, and activities under the regional development plans.

All central offices of government agencies are hereby directed to prioritize key RDC-endorsed programs, projects and activities in their investment programs and annual budgets, and provide feedback through their regional offices to the RDCs on their actions.

The Bangsamoro Autonomous Region in Muslim Mindanao and Metro Manila, pursuant to Republic Acts 11054 and 7924, are not covered by EO 82.

The NEDA is mandated to issue the necessary guidelines for the implementation of EO 82, within 60 working days from the effectivity of the order.

The guidelines should include the framework for the preparation and approval of the manual of operations of RDCs; mechanism for the selection of a Secretary or other officers for each RDC, including their duties and functions; and rules on vacancy and succession of RDC officials and officers.

The funding requirements for the initial implementation of EO 82 will be charged against the current and available appropriations of NEDA and such other sources as may be identified by the DBM.

The budget needed for the continued implementation of the order will be included in the budget proposals of NEDA, subject to the usual budget preparation process. (EVCommunities)
